Obter requisitos de operação de salvamento (índice de função 2)
Essa função interface _DSM para classe de função endereçável de energia endereçável de bytes (Interface de Função 1) retorna informações sobre os requisitos de hardware para uma operação de salvamento. Essa função terá êxito em todos os NVDIMM-Ns que dão suporte a uma política de ES (fonte de energia) gerenciada por host. Ele poderá retornar uma falha status se o dispositivo der suporte à política de ES gerenciada pelo dispositivo e os requisitos de operação de salvamento não estiverem disponíveis.
Os registros são definidos na especificação interface de energia endereçável de bytes.
Entrada
Arg3
Nenhum.
Saída
Campo | Comprimento do byte | Deslocamento de bytes | Registre-se | Descrição |
---|---|---|---|---|
Status | 4 | 0 | Essa função pode retornar o seguinte Function-Specific Código de Erro: O NVDIMM-N não relata os requisitos de operação de salvamento. Para obter mais informações, consulte saída do método _DSM. | |
Requisito médio de energia | 2 | 4 | Byte 0: CSAVE_POWER_REQ0 (0, 0x29); Byte 1: CSAVE_POWER_REQ1 (0, 0x2A) | A potência média (em miliwatts) necessária para a operação de salvamento. |
Requisito de energia ociosa | 2 | 6 | Byte 0: CSAVE_IDLE_POWER_REQ0 (0, 0x2B); Byte 1: CSAVE_IDLE_POWER_REQ1 (0, 0x2C) | A potência média (em miliwatts) que o módulo requer após a conclusão da operação de salvamento. |
Requisito mínimo de tensão | 2 | 8 | Byte 0: CSAVE_MIN_VOLT_REQ0 (0, 0x2D); Byte 1: CSAVE_MIN_VOLT_REQ1 (0, 0x2E) | A tensão mínima (em milisvoltas) que o ES precisa atender durante uma operação de salvamento. |
Requisito máximo de tensão | 2 | 10 | Byte 0: CSAVE_MAX_VOLT_REQ0 (0, 0x2F); Byte 1: CSAVE_MAX_VOLT_REQ1 (0, 0x30) | A tensão máxima (em milisvoltas) que o ES precisa atender durante uma operação de salvamento. |